Before buying Bluetooth audio smart glasses, define where they will earn their place. Do you need hands-free calls during commuting, quiet navigation while walking, or background audio during household tasks? Each use demands different performance. For calls, test microphone clarity near traffic. For podcasts, check whether voices remain understandable at low volume. For outdoor use, wind resistance matters more than impressive specifications.
Picture a normal morning. You are carrying groceries, answering a call, and crossing a busy street. Open-ear audio can keep your ears aware of nearby sounds, but it should never replace careful attention. Use a comfortable volume, especially in crowded areas. Some models feel light for ten minutes, then press against the nose or temples. That small discomfort becomes important after an hour. I would test the glasses with your usual prescription lenses, if needed, and walk indoors and outdoors before deciding.
Think about control, too. Physical buttons may work better than touch controls in rain or cold weather. Battery claims can change with calls, louder playback, and frequent charging. Ask how long the glasses last under your actual routine, not an ideal laboratory test. I once focused too heavily on audio quality and overlooked charging convenience. That was a poor trade-off. A useful pair should fit your daily habits, not force you to redesign them.
Buying Bluetooth audio smart glasses requires more than stylish frames. Test them with speech, music, and outdoor noise. Audio should sound clear, not merely loud. Listen for balanced voices and controlled bass. Poor tuning becomes tiring during a long walk. Ask whether the speakers leak sound nearby. In a quiet shop, leakage may seem minor. On a train, it can feel awkward. Comfort also affects perceived audio quality. Frames pressing behind your ears can ruin an otherwise strong listening experience.
Examine controls while wearing the glasses. Physical buttons are easier to find than tiny touch surfaces. Try play, pause, volume, calls, and voice commands without looking. Keep it simple. A reliable pause button matters when crossing a street or speaking with someone. Controls should respond quickly, but accidental taps are frustrating. Test microphone clarity in a breezy place. The other caller should hear natural speech, not wind bursts. I once focused too heavily on sound and overlooked button placement. That mistake made daily use less convenient.
Wireless connectivity deserves a practical test. Pair the glasses with your phone, then walk several rooms away. Connection should remain stable through normal indoor obstacles. Check reconnection after Bluetooth is disabled briefly. Battery estimates also need skepticism; higher volume and calls reduce endurance. Look for charging behavior, software permissions, and update support. Compatibility with your phone matters. Some advertised features may work only on selected devices. Read technical specifications, then verify them in real use. A short trial reveals more than a polished product description.

Check comfort before features. In a fitting test, I wear the glasses for at least fifteen minutes. Pressure behind the ears often appears late. The bridge should rest securely without leaving deep marks. Choose a balanced frame, because front-heavy glasses can cause headaches. Move your head gently. They should stay in place. A small adjustment may improve comfort more than a higher specification.
Test the audio in a quiet room, then near ordinary street noise. Clear speech matters more than impressive volume. Keep listening levels comfortable for long use. Examine the controls with one hand. Buttons should be easy to find without looking. Check microphone performance by recording a short voice message. Wind can expose weaknesses quickly. Review the battery estimate under real use, not only laboratory conditions.
Lens choices deserve equal attention. Select clear, tinted, photochromic, or prescription-compatible lenses for your routine. Confirm optical clarity across the entire lens, especially near the edges. If protection is claimed, look for reliable test information. Inspect the hinges, charging contacts, and frame seams. Water resistance ratings can help, but they may not cover every component. Try the glasses with your usual hat or helmet. They may fit badly together. I once overlooked this detail, and the glasses became uncomfortable within minutes. Small compromises matter. Check the return policy, replacement lens process, and warranty terms before purchasing.

Battery life needs a real-world check. Advertised figures often assume moderate volume and limited calls. Test playback for 60 minutes, then inspect the battery drop. Charging speed matters during a commute. A case that provides several extra charges is useful, but bulky cases can become annoying. Bluetooth SIG’s 2024 Market Update forecasts 5.4 billion Bluetooth device shipments annually by 2028, making compatibility increasingly important. Confirm support for your phone’s operating system, Bluetooth version, preferred codec, and multipoint connections. Do not assume every feature works equally across devices.
Privacy deserves equal attention. Examine microphone permissions, voice-recording controls, data deletion options, encryption statements, and firmware-update policies. A visible microphone indicator helps nearby people understand when listening or recording may occur. The 2024 Consumer Privacy Survey reported that 75% of respondents would avoid organizations they did not trust with personal data. That figure is sobering. Read the privacy policy, even if it feels tedious. Check whether voice data is processed on the device or uploaded to remote servers. Also review the companion app’s background permissions; this is an easy detail to miss. Pew Research Center reported in 2024 that about 90% of U.S. adults own smartphones, yet ownership does not guarantee seamless pairing. Test calls, music, notifications, and reconnection before buying. Battery ratings are imperfect. Your daily habits matter more.
| Tip | Evaluation Dimension | Practical Data or Benchmark | What to Check Before Buying | Why It Matters |
|---|---|---|---|---|
| 1 | Battery Life | Many audio smart glasses provide approximately 3–8 hours of continuous playback, while charging cases can add several full recharges. | Compare playback time with calls, music, voice-assistant use, and volume enabled. Confirm whether the advertised figure excludes phone calls or other intensive functions. | Real-world battery life is usually lower than laboratory figures, especially at high volume or during frequent calls. |
| 2 | Charging and Battery Replacement | A full charge commonly takes about 1–2 hours; many integrated batteries are not user-replaceable. | Check charging-port or charging-case type, charging indicators, pass-through limitations, spare-case availability, and the manufacturer’s battery-service policy. | A convenient charging system reduces downtime and may extend the usable life of the glasses. |
| 3 | Privacy and Recording Controls | Audio-only glasses generally present lower privacy risk than models with cameras, but microphones may still collect voice data through calls or assistants. | Look for a visible recording indicator, physical microphone mute, clear permission controls, local-processing options, data-deletion tools, and a published privacy policy. | Visible controls and transparent data practices help protect both the wearer and people nearby. |
| 4 | Device and Operating-System Compatibility | Basic Bluetooth audio can work with many recent phones, but companion apps may require specific Android or iOS versions and permissions. | Verify supported operating-system versions, app-store availability, Bluetooth profiles such as A2DP and HFP, multipoint support, and tablet or computer compatibility. | Bluetooth version numbers alone do not guarantee access to every audio codec, app feature, or operating-system function. |
| 5 | Audio Quality and Call Performance | Open-ear speakers keep the ears uncovered and improve environmental awareness, but they generally provide less isolation and bass impact than sealed earbuds. | Test speech clarity, wind-noise reduction, maximum comfortable volume, audio leakage, latency, and performance in quiet and busy environments. | The best design depends on whether the priority is awareness, music detail, private listening, or reliable calls. |
| 6 | Comfort, Fit, and Durability | Long-term comfort depends on frame weight, temple pressure, nose-pad design, lens fit, and balance. Water resistance is commonly expressed with an IP rating. | Check total weight, available frame sizes, prescription-lens support, hinge strength, sweat resistance, and the exact IP rating. An IP rating does not automatically mean protection against swimming or submersion. | A comfortable and appropriately protected frame is more likely to be worn consistently and safely. |
| 7 | Controls, Safety, and Support | Common controls include physical buttons, touch surfaces, voice commands, and automatic audio pausing. Safety depends on maintaining awareness of surrounding traffic and people. | Confirm control response, accidental-touch resistance, volume limits, firmware-update support, warranty length, return terms, repair options, and availability of replacement frames or lenses. | Reliable controls and long-term support can matter as much as sound quality when the glasses are used daily. |
Note: Battery performance, compatibility, water resistance, and privacy functions vary by model. Always confirm the latest technical specifications and software requirements before purchase.
Price is only the opening number. Grand View Research estimates the global smart glasses market could grow at about 27% annually through 2030. Rising demand may encourage frequent product refreshes. Ask whether the purchase still feels sensible after two years. Compare the glasses, charging case, prescription lenses, shipping, and optional accessories. A low sticker price can become expensive quickly.
Support matters. Check the warranty length, repair process, software update policy, and replacement battery options. The International Data Corporation reports that wearable device shipments remain highly competitive, with vendors under pressure to release new models. That can shorten practical support cycles. Confirm whether the companion app works with your phone’s current operating system. Also test call quality in traffic, wind, and a quiet room. Short demonstrations can hide connection drops.
Look beyond launch day. Battery capacity usually declines with repeated charging, and small components may be difficult to replace. Read independent reviews after several months, not only first-week impressions. The Consumer Technology Association’s consumer research repeatedly shows that reliability and ease of use influence technology purchases alongside price. That matches practical buying experience, though no survey predicts every user’s routine. I would also question unclear privacy settings and vague repair promises. Stylish frames are useful, but dependable support creates the real long-term value.
